Abstract

This study aims to analyze the effectiveness of the e-Court system in improving the efficiency of the judicial process at the Maros Class 1B Religious Court. In this case, the field research is qualitative, using a qualitative approach with the aim of explaining what actually happens in the field descriptively with an analysis method in order to be able to understand more thoroughly the research location to obtain appropriate data, by obtaining oral and written data at the research location located at the Maros Class 1B Religious Court.The results of the study indicate that the use of e-court in fulfilling the efficiency of the case resolution process at the Maros Class 1B Religious Court cannot be said to be fully efficient, there are several stages that still have obstacles, at the registration stage (e-filling) it is completely said to be efficient for court employees and the parties to the case, the second stage of the payment stage (e-payment) is easy but the obstacles at the Maros Class 1B Religious Court at this stage there are other obstacles such as parties who do not pay attention to the payment deadline, which results in them being late in getting the case number. Furthermore, at the Summons stage (e-summons) the obstacle faced by the court is that PT. POS does not understand the summons rules. As well as the trial stage (e-litigation) there are obstacles found for the parties, namely uploading the wrong documents.
